Frankie Muniz's Controversial Departure from 'Malcolm in the Middle' Set

Frankie Muniz revealed that he walked off the set of "Malcolm in the Middle" for two episodes due to the tense atmosphere where people were afraid to stand up to disrespectful behavior. Reflecting on his experience as a child actor, he expressed concern about the industry, despite his own positive experience, and stated that he wouldn't let his own child enter the business. Muniz, who has mostly left acting for a NASCAR career, still holds fondness for his "Malcolm" family and expressed interest in revisiting the show, as did co-star Bryan Cranston.

"Kelly Rowland's Rep Addresses 'Today' Show Walk-Off Controversy"

Kelly Rowland's representative addressed the singer's walk-off from the "Today" show, stating that she and her team were unhappy with the dressing room. Hoda Kotb offered to share her dressing room with Rowland, and Rita Ora filled in for her at the last minute. Despite the drama, Kotb expressed admiration for Rowland and welcomed her back on the show, while others criticized the situation. Rowland herself has not directly addressed the controversy.

"Dana White's Abrupt Exit from Howie Mandel's Podcast Sparks Controversy"

UFC president Dana White abruptly walked off Howie Mandel's podcast after just 30 seconds, citing exhaustion from doing podcasts. Mandel had showered White with compliments, including calling him a philosopher, which may have contributed to White's flustered reaction. While the incident could be a publicity stunt, White's history of antagonism towards media adds complexity to the situation.

Stanford Secures College World Series Spot with Miracle Win.

Stanford defeated Texas 7-6 in a winner-take-all super regional game, with junior Drew Bowser hitting a walk-off RBI single in the bottom of the ninth inning. Bowser also homered for the third consecutive game and finished 2-for-4 with three RBIs and two runs scored. Stanford will now travel to Omaha for the College World Series, where they will face No. 1 Wake Forest in their first game.
